Learn more about Gujo

Learn traditional Japanese dance at the Gujo Odori festival, where locals welcome visitors to join nightly performances throughout summer. Explore the pristine Yoshida River running through town, perfect for swimming in designated areas or watching master craftsmen create realistic food replicas.

Frequently asked questions

What is the best area to stay in Gujo?
The best area to stay in Gujo is Gujo Hachiman, the town's historic heart.

This neighbourhood is the main hub for visitors, known for its well-preserved Edo-period streets, traditional waterways, and the iconic Gujo Hachiman Castle perched on Mount Hachiman. It's very walkable, with many local shops, restaurants, and museums clustered around the Yoshida River and the main shopping streets like Shokunin-machi and Kajiya-machi. The town's layout, with its intricate water systems, is a key feature.

Couples often find Gujo Hachiman ideal for a culturally rich and relaxing trip. You can enjoy strolls along the canals, visit the Gujo Hachiman Hakurankan Museum to learn about the town's history and traditions, or explore the castle for panoramic views. The evening atmosphere is particularly pleasant, with traditional lanterns illuminating the streets.

For families, Gujo Hachiman offers a unique blend of education and gentle exploration. Children often enjoy watching the traditional water systems at work, participating in food replica making workshops (Gujo is famous for this.), or simply exploring the castle grounds.

When is the best time to go to Gujo?
The best time to go to Gujo is during the summer months, particularly July and August, if you wish to experience the famed Gujo Odori dance festival.

The Gujo Odori is a traditional Japanese dance festival with a history spanning over 400 years. It typically runs for 32 nights between mid-July and early September, with the peak four nights in mid-August seeing dancing continue all through the night. The main stages and dance areas are spread throughout Gujo Hachiman, the central town area, around landmarks like the Gujo Hachiman Castle and the Yoshida River.

Couples looking for a unique cultural experience will find this period particularly rewarding. You can participate in the evening dances, explore the historic streets during the day, and enjoy the town's traditional craft shops and local cuisine. Many local inns and guesthouses offer dance lesson packages, which can be a great way to engage with the local culture.

For those who prefer a quieter visit with pleasant weather for exploring the town and surrounding nature, late spring (April to May) and autumn (October to November) are also excellent.
